Langkawi residents have begun moving towards digital TV broadcast since 21 July 2019 after the analogue TV transmission from Gunung Raya was replaced with the myFreeview digital broadcasting service which offers better broadcast quality. The government today announced the nationwide pilot transition of analogue TV to digital TV transmission in stages until 30 September 2019. This rides on the back of a successful pilot transition held in Langkawi on 21 July 2019. Malaysias transition to digital TV broadcast to be conducted in stages Tuesday 06 Aug 2019 0717 PM MYT Gobind said the myFreeview platform currently offers 15 TV channels with plans to add six radio channels. Malaysia switching to full digital TV broadcast by Oct 31 Tuesday 24 Sep 2019 0712 PM MYT MCMC said the transition from analogue TV broadcast to myFreeview Digital TV will start in the central and southern regions on September 30 northern and eastern regions on October 14 while Sabah and Sarawak will make the switch on October 31.
